设置单个网页密码可以通过HTML的基本认证(Basic Authentication)来实现。这种方式要求用户提供用户名和密码才能访问页面内容。以下是如何设置单个网页密码的步骤:

1. 创建一个密码文件:首先需要创建一个包含用户名和密码的密码文件。这个密码文件一般采用.htpasswd格式,其中存储了经过加密后的用户名和密码信息。可以使用在线工具或者服务器提供的命令行工具生成.htpasswd文件。
2. 在网站根目录下创建.htaccess文件:在需要设置密码保护的网页所在目录下创建一个名为.htaccess的文件。如果已经存在.htaccess文件,可以直接编辑该文件。.htaccess文件是一个用于配置Apache服务器的文件,可以控制访问权限等功能。
3. 在.htaccess文件中添加认证规则:打开.htaccess文件,并添加以下代码来定义基本认证规则:
AuthType Basic
AuthName "Restricted Area"
AuthUserFile /path/to/password/file/.htpasswd
Require valid-user
在这段代码中,AuthType指定认证类型为Basic,AuthName定义了需要进行认证的区域名称,AuthUserFile指定了密码文件的路径,Require valid-user表示需要提供有效的用户名和密码才能访问页面。
4. 保存并上传文件:保存.htaccess文件并上传到服务器相应目录下。
5. 测试验证效果:打开网页试图访问被保护的页面时,会要求输入用户名和密码。输入正确的用户名和密码后即可访问页面内容。
需要注意的是,基本认证并不是最安全的身份验证方式,因为用户名和密码是以Base64编码形式传输的,容易被拦截。因此,建议在HTTPS协议下使用基本认证,以确保传输的安全性。
设置单个网页密码保护可以用于限制某些页面的访问权限,例如内部文件、敏感数据等。同时,也可以通过.htaccess文件设置不同的认证规则来保护多个页面或目录。希望以上步骤对您能有所帮助。

查看详情

查看详情